Abstract
The utility model relates to a valve, in particular to a novel check valve and belongs to the field of machining. The novel check valve comprises an end cover, a body, a gasket, a valve seat and a spring seat. The valve seat is fixed on the end cover, and the spring seat is fixed on the body. A disc valve is arranged between the valve seat and the spring seat, and eight disc valve teeth are arranged on the disc valve. A spring groove is formed in the disc valve, and a spring is arranged between the spring seat and the spring groove. According to the novel check valve, due to the fact that face sealing is utilized by the check valve, so that the stiffness coefficient of the spring is reduced, and the opening pressure is reduced. The novel check valve is suitable for being used for steam or water or other media. In addition, the novel check valve is reasonable in structural design, convenient to use, overhaul and maintain.

Background technique
In fields such as chemical industry, pharmacy, the use of safety check is seen everywhere.Safety check claims again check valve, one-way valve or check valve, and its effect is to prevent medium directional flow in pipeline and the function of unlikely refluence.The working principle of spring loaded check valve is, liquid flows into valve body by import, relies on the spring controlled flap of pressure jack-up, and after pressure disappeared, spring force was depressed flap, and sealing liquid flows backwards.Yet common safety check is most adopts the seal rings sealing, and such design seal ring in use easily damages, and it is large to open the cracking pressure of valve.

Embodiment
By reference to the accompanying drawings the utility model is described in further detail now.The schematic diagram of accompanying drawing for simplifying basic structure of the present utility model only is described in a schematic way, so it only shows the formation relevant with the utility model.
See also Fig. 1, Fig. 2 and Fig. 3, a kind of non-return valve, comprise end cap 1, body 2, packing ring 3, valve seat 4 and spring seat 6, described valve seat 4 is fixed on end cap 1, described spring seat 6 is fixed on body 2, is provided with plate valve 8 between described valve seat 4 and spring seat 6, and described plate valve 8 is provided with 8 plate valve teeth 9, described plate valve 8 is provided with spring groove 7, is provided with spring 5 between described spring seat 6 and spring groove 7.
A kind of non-return valve that the utility model is related, in use, medium enters safety check from the end cap side, due to the existence of pressure medium, pressure can promote plate valve 8 and make spring contraction, and at this moment medium will pass through in the space between plate valve tooth 9, when pressure medium disappears, spring will recover elastic strain, and the elastic force of spring can make plate valve be close to valve seat, thereby medium can't be flow backwards.In a word, this safety check is provided with plate valve, comes the one-way flow of control media by the opening and closing of crossing plate valve, with the sealing of employing face, reduces spring rate due to this safety check, makes cracking pressure reduce.This safety check is applicable to the use of the media such as steam or water.In addition, this check valve structure is reasonable in design, and is easy to use, easy access and maintenance.
